Output dd34a10606a48676f7e2a83d51d25e420931a7cf09b40ee54e23966210ecab80:0

value
617893524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 481d7a54a1bba641429210cb9634ba1a31b54bbb OP_EQUALVERIFY OP_CHECKSIG
address
17aJxyCfTosKezK6XYxrUsrxUsUB3CSCDL
transaction
dd34a10606a48676f7e2a83d51d25e420931a7cf09b40ee54e23966210ecab80
confirmations
546096
spent
true